Sub jjj() Cells.Replace What:=ChrW(8381), Replacement:="", LookAt:=xlPart, SearchOrder:=xlByRows, _ MatchCase:=False, SearchFormat:=False, ReplaceFormat:=False End Sub
[/vba]
[vba]
Код
Sub jjj() Cells.Replace What:=ChrW(8381), Replacement:="", LookAt:=xlPart, SearchOrder:=xlByRows, _ MatchCase:=False, SearchFormat:=False, ReplaceFormat:=False End Sub
Sub SEVERNAYA_DOLINA() Dim r As Range Dim rgn As Range Set rgn = Application.ActiveSheet.UsedRange For Each r In rgn.Cells If (r.Cells.Interior.ColorIndex <> 6) And (r.Cells.Interior.ColorIndex <> -4142) Then r.Cells.ClearContents End If Next End Sub
как его заставить работать по всей книге а не только по активной sheet? [moder]Вопрос к данной теме не относится. И код следует оформлять тегами (кнопка #). Читайте Правила форума[/moder]
и вдогонку еще один вопрос,есть вот такой код
Sub SEVERNAYA_DOLINA() Dim r As Range Dim rgn As Range Set rgn = Application.ActiveSheet.UsedRange For Each r In rgn.Cells If (r.Cells.Interior.ColorIndex <> 6) And (r.Cells.Interior.ColorIndex <> -4142) Then r.Cells.ClearContents End If Next End Sub
как его заставить работать по всей книге а не только по активной sheet? [moder]Вопрос к данной теме не относится. И код следует оформлять тегами (кнопка #). Читайте Правила форума[/moder]lamak58
Сообщение отредактировал Pelena - Вторник, 14.06.2016, 16:19